What Are Smart Curtains & Blinds

Smart curtain and blind motors allow you to automate your window coverings with schedules, voice commands, and app control. Whether you want sunlight management, privacy, or convenience, these motors upgrade any room with modern functionality and smooth operation.

Why Smart Curtains & Blinds Are Popular

Automated Daily Light Control

Set schedules for sunrise, sunset, privacy hours, or heat-reduction during hot afternoons.

Voice & App Convenience

Control all curtains and blinds using Alexa, Google, or your smart home app.

Smooth & Quiet Operation

Modern motors provide soft, silent motion ideal for bedrooms and living rooms.

Great for Hard-to-Reach Windows

Perfect for tall windows or places where manual opening is inconvenient.

TYPES OF SMART CURTAIN & BLIND SYSTEMS

1️⃣ Curtain Track Motors (With Tracks)

Complete systems that include a motor + track. These slide the curtain open/closed smoothly and are ideal for new installations.

2️⃣ Retrofit Curtain Motors (Attach to Existing Tracks)

Motors that clip onto most existing U- or I-type tracks. No full replacement required.

3️⃣ Smart Roller Blind Motors (Internal Tube Motors)

Motors installed inside the roller tube. Suitable for blackout, sunscreen, or zebra blinds.

4️⃣ Chain-Drive Smart Blind Motors

Attach to the existing chain loop and pull the chain automatically. Great retrofit option for rental homes.

5️⃣ Robotic Curtain Openers

Small smart robots that hang on curtain rods or tracks and physically pull the curtain. Affordable and fully DIY.

Compatibility & Technical Notes

Smart Curtains & Blinds typically follow these compatibility rules:

  • Connectivity:

Most motors support Zigbee or Wi-Fi, while some premium systems support Matter (mainly through bridges).

  • Hub Requirement:

Zigbee models require a Zigbee hub. Wi-Fi motors connect directly to the router or manufacturer app.

  • Ecosystem Integration:

Motors can usually be integrated into Tuya, Alexa, Google Home, and sometimes HomeKit(via Matter bridges).

  • Power Options:

Available in plug-in, wired, and rechargeable battery models depending on the motor type.

  • Track Compatibility:

Curtain motors must match track type — U-track, I-track, or rod mount depending on the system.

  • Roller Blind Requirements:

Roller motors must match tube diameter (38mm, 45mm, 50mm, etc.). Chain-drive add-ons work with most loop-chain rollers.

  • Network Stability:

Zigbee motors benefit from a strong mesh network if placed far from the hub.

Do all curtain motors require a hub?

Wi-Fi models do not, but Zigbee models require a Zigbee hub for automation and better stability.
